Axiome
Un axiome, ou un postulat, est une prémisse ou un point de départ du raisonnement. Comme l'a conçu classiquement, un axiome est une prémisse si évidente qu'il faut accepter comme vraie sans controverse. Le mot provient du ἀξίωμα grec (āxīoma), ce qui est considéré comme digne ou en forme "ou" ce qui se félicite comme il est évident ". Tel qu'utilisé dans la logique moderne, un axiome est simplement une prémisse ou un point de départ pour le raisonnement. Les axiomes définissent et délimitent le domaine de l'analyse; La vérité relative d'un axiome est prise pour acquis dans le domaine particulier de l'analyse et sert de point de départ pour déduire et inférer d'autres vérités relatives. Aucune vision explicite de la vérité absolue des axiomes n'est jamais prise dans le contexte des mathématiques modernes, car une telle chose est considérée comme une contradiction non pertinente et impossible en termes. En mathématiques, le terme axiome est utilisé dans deux sens apparentés mais distinctifs: «axiomes logiques» et «axiomes non logiques». définition de postulate dans le dictionnaire anglais
La première définition du postulat dans le dictionnaire est de supposer être vrai ou existant; prendre pour acquis. Une autre définition du postulat est de demander, exiger ou réclamer. Le postulat consiste également à désigner un poste ou un bureau soumis à l'approbation d'une autorité supérieure.
